The Social Worker provides psychosocial assessments, crisis intervention, and discharge planning for patients in acute medical, surgical, and geriatric settings. They also act as a liaison for community resources and provide clinical supervision to social work students.
Candidates must hold a Master of Social Work (MSW) degree and maintain current membership with OASW and OCCSWSSW. Experience in acute or sub-acute care sectors and proficiency in electronic documentation are required.
MSW obtained from an accredited school of Social Work required. Current membership with OASW and OCCSWSSW, or eligibility to become a member required. Experience in the acute and/or sub-acute sector system, patient flow and discharge planning is an asset and preferred. Computer skills required; ability to manage electronic recording, workload and meet submission timelines. Demonstrated knowledge of the acute, sub-acute and community sector. Knowledge of community resources an asset. Demonstrated organizational skills to set clinical and non-clinical priorities in a fast paced environment. Demonstrated ability to work independently and in a team environment. Demonstrated excellence in interpersonal skills. Excellent communication skills (oral and written) facilitating effective communication in case reporting and assessments, with patients, families, peers, other healthcare team members and volunteers. Excellent decision making skills. Demonstrates cross cultural awareness and sensitivity. Excellent attendance and discipline free record required. An understanding of equity, diversity, and inclusion principles as they relate to health practices is an asset.
